Grayish Blue

The color #878FAE is a grayish blue that can be used in various design contexts. This color has RGB values of 135, 143, 174 and HSL values of 228°, 19%, 61%.

Complementary Colors for #878FAE

The complementary color for #878FAE is #AEA789. These colors sit opposite each other on the color wheel and create a striking visual contrast when used together.

Analogous Colors for #878FAE

The analogous colors for #878FAE are #89A3AE and #9489AE. These three colors sit next to each other on the color wheel, creating a natural and harmonious color combination.

Triadic Colors for #878FAE

The triadic colors for #878FAE are #AE8990 and #90AE89. These three colors are evenly spaced around the color wheel, offering a vibrant and balanced color combination.
